How did the Reign of Terror change France?
anzhelika [568]

Answer: The Reign of Terror instituted the conscripted army, which saved France from invasion by other countries and in that sense preserved the Revolution. ... During the Reign of Terror, at least 300,000 suspects were arrested; 17,000 were officially executed, and perhaps 10,000 died in prison or without trial.
